Sometimes we give an artist his/her/their first cover thinking he/she/them will be the biggest artists in the world someday, sometimes we just think they are great right at that particular moment. To wit, the above split of Kano and Bloc Party from F29. Now we're not saying they both couldn't make spectacular comebacks and recapture what made us put them on in the first place, but Kano has a lot of ground to recover and this new Bloc Party single, "Mercury", debuted on Zane Lowe's BBC1 show today, isn't exactly vintage BP. Still, at least they aren't resting on their post-punk/nu wave/disco-punk (or whatever people were calling it in 2006) laurels, and hey, who doesn't love them some astrology?
